Supreme Court of Rhode Island

Merlyn O'Keefe v. Myrth York

February 22, 2024

Summary

The Supreme Court of Rhode Island affirmed the Superior Court’s denial of both the plaintiffs’ request for a permanent injunction and their adverse‑possession claims concerning a privately owned road. The Court found no credible evidence that the defendants’ alleged obstructions amounted to a trespass that ousted the plaintiffs, and held that the plaintiffs failed to meet the heightened burden required for adverse possession against cotenants.
